I mod my REV with P200 as well, it definitely works in lower wind range.

i do have a indoor frame cut down to a 1.5 size and i do love the skyshark tapers as well .. the ss tapers do have more flex then the rev rods do but peform very nice .. out of the 2 i like the indoor skinnys the best for the 0 to 3 range any more then that the race rods do best.. the looks of that new sprit however is truely PIMP!!!im in the works for one of those

the sprit is eazy to fly a great beginner kite that is extremely eazy to control .. the downside to the sprit is that to get it to fly to my standerds it took me a while to tune the bridle.. youll have to put in some work on that one other then that its a great kite looks wise .. as for the rev well that is the best of the 2 the rev is ready to go out of the bag and control its way more precice then the sprit.. i like the sprit because of the batwing design .. but top choise for control and good flying would be the rev 1.5 or b series
